Diphtheria Did Not Develope Here.

The 11 months old infant which died last Thursday morning of diphtheria, at the home of Mr. and Mrs. Matt Worden, was the motherless obild of Charles Clowry, of Remington, whiob Mrs. Warden had taken to raise. It is not known where it oontraoted the disease but Mrs. Warden had recyfitly been away vis ting, taking the babe with hey, and it is sapposed it was oontraoted while on this visit.
